The Verdict: Which is Better?

When placing 72% Cacao Dark Chocolate and Chocolate Chip Cookie Dough side-by-side, the nutritional differences become quite clear. Both products cater to specific dietary needs, but picking the right one depends on whether you are prioritizing weight loss, muscle gain, or clean eating.

72% Cacao Dark Chocolate is the more energy-dense option here, packing 44 more calories per 100g than Chocolate Chip Cookie Dough. If you are looking for sustained energy or fueling a workout, this higher caloric density might be an advantage.

In terms of sugar control, 72% Cacao Dark Chocolate takes the lead with only 26.7g of sugar per 100g, whereas Chocolate Chip Cookie Dough contains 35.6g. Lower sugar content is often linked to better metabolic health.
